localisation actuelle:Maison > Articles techniques > base de données
- Direction:
- tous web3.0 développement back-end interface Web base de données Opération et maintenance outils de développement cadre php Problème commun autre technologie Tutoriel CMS Java Tutoriel système tutoriels informatiques Tutoriel matériel Tutoriel mobile Tutoriel logiciel Tutoriel de jeu mobile
- Classer:
-
- Comment les différentes instances de redis communiquent
- Il existe plusieurs mécanismes de communication entre les instances Redis: Pub / Sub: Mode Publish / Sub, permettant une messagerie efficace et à faible latence. Mode de cluster: méthode de déploiement distribué, offrant une haute disponibilité et une tolérance aux défauts. Commande d'installation croisée: permet d'envoyer directement les commandes à une autre instance, adaptée à des fins opérationnelles ou administratives temporaires.
- Redis 650 2025-04-10 17:15:01
-
- Comment implémenter le multi-threading avec redis
- Redis implémente le multi-lancement en combinant intelligemment le mode des réacteurs, le pool de threads et les mécanismes internes multi-threading, en utilisant ainsi efficacement les processeurs multi-core, en améliorant le débit, en optimisant l'utilisation des ressources, en maintenant une faible latence et en améliorant l'évolutivité et en répondant à différents besoins de charge.
- Redis 884 2025-04-10 17:12:01
-
- Comment afficher la version redis actuelle
- Ce guide fournit deux façons de déterminer la version Redis actuelle: utilisez la commande info pour obtenir le numéro de version. Utilisez l'option --version pour afficher directement le numéro de version. Le numéro de version se compose du numéro de version principale, du numéro de version secondaire et du numéro de révision, qui représentent respectivement les grandes mises à jour de version, les améliorations fonctionnelles et les corrections de bogues mineurs.
- Redis 309 2025-04-10 17:09:01
-
- Comment nettoyer toutes les données avec Redis
- Comment nettoyer toutes les données Redis: redis 2.8 et ultérieurement: La commande Flushall supprime toutes les paires de valeurs clés. Redis 2.6 et plus tôt: utilisez la commande del pour supprimer les clés une par une ou utilisez le client redis pour supprimer les méthodes. Alternative: redémarrez le service redis (utilisez avec prudence) ou utilisez le client redis (tel que Flushall () ou FlushDB ()).
- Redis 797 2025-04-10 17:06:01
-
- Comment enregistrer le type de liste Redis
- Redis utilise un tableau interne pour stocker le type de liste, chaque élément du tableau est une valeur de chaîne représentant un membre. Redis maintient également un comptoir pour suivre le nombre d'éléments dans le tableau. Lorsque vous utilisez la commande LPUSH ou RPUSH, Redis met à jour le compteur et insère ou ajoute de nouveaux éléments dans le tableau. La commande LRange renvoie les membres dans la plage donnée, LSET met à jour les membres de l'index spécifié et LREM supprime les membres qui correspondent à la valeur donnée. La méthode de sauvegarde du type de liste de Redis prend en charge les opérations efficaces d'insertion, de suppression et de recherche.
- Redis 672 2025-04-10 17:03:01
-
- Comment afficher l'état de course de redis
- Vérifiez l'état d'exécution Redis en utilisant la commande redis Info pour obtenir des statistiques de serveur. Surveillez Redis en temps réel à l'aide d'outils de surveillance tels que RedisInsight, Prometheus et Grafana. Vérifiez les informations du processus (PS Aux | Grep Redis) pour obtenir l'utilisation du processeur et de la mémoire. Affichez le fichier journal (tail /var/log/redis/redis.log) pour trouver des erreurs et des messages d'avertissement. Utilisez une commande dédiée telle que Sentinel Slaves Mymaster pour obtenir des informations d'instance spécifiques.
- Redis 249 2025-04-10 17:00:02
-
- Comment atteindre une grande concurrence avec Redis
- Redis obtient une concurrence élevée grâce aux mécanismes suivants: boucle d'événement unique, multiplexage d'E / S, structure de données sans verrouillage, délétion paresseuse, pipelined, regroupement de connexion client et mode évolutif au cluster.
- Redis 965 2025-04-10 16:57:01
-
- Comment Redis prend en charge la haute disponibilité
- Redis est un système de cache distribué hautement disponible qui fournit plusieurs mécanismes: réplication maître-esclave: le nœud maître stocke les données, la réplication synchrone avec le nœud esclave, améliore les performances de lecture et atteint un basculement rapide. Sentinel: Surveillez les groupes de réplication et faites la promotion des nœuds esclaves pour maîtriser les nœuds pendant le basculement. Cluster: Système distribué, chaque nœud stocke une partie des données, atteignant la haute disponibilité et l'évolutivité. Basculement du client: le client se connecte automatiquement au nouveau nœud maître après le basculement pour améliorer la disponibilité.
- Redis 558 2025-04-10 16:54:01
-
- Comment le verrou Redis est-il mis en œuvre
- Les verrous Redis sont mis en œuvre en tirant parti des opérations SETNX et del Atomic de Redis, ainsi que des caractéristiques d'exécution à thread unique. Il implémente le verrouillage en définissant les paires de valeurs de clé, déverrouille à l'aide de Del Delete Keys et définit le temps d'expiration pour éviter les impasses. Les verrous redis sont simples et faciles à utiliser, hautes performances et distribués, mais en s'appuyant sur Redis, ils ont un risque de point de défaillance unique et le délai d'expiration de verrouillage peut conduire à des données incohérentes.
- Redis 847 2025-04-10 16:51:01
-
- Comment mettre en œuvre le partage de session avec Redis
- Redis implémente le partage de session, en utilisant des sessions collantes, implémente la séparation de lecture et d'écriture et définit un mécanisme d'expiration de session pour obtenir des performances élevées, une évolutivité, une tolérance aux défauts et une flexibilité. Les étapes spécifiques incluent: le stockage des données de session dans la table Redis Hash, la définition de sessions collantes, la mise en œuvre de la séparation de lecture et d'écriture, la configuration des mécanismes d'expiration de la session et l'utilisation de middleware ou frameworks de session.
- Redis 636 2025-04-10 16:48:01
-
- Comment implémenter la structure de données sous-jacente de redis
- Redis implémente divers types de données en utilisant les structures de données sous-jacentes suivantes: Tableau de hachage: Key-Value Pair Storage Table: Recherche rapide de la recherche de données de données commandées: Liste compressée du préfixe: stockage compact de petites chaînes et listes entières: listes de données liées à la bibliothèque, files d'attente et piles
- Redis 422 2025-04-10 16:45:01
-
- Comment reproduire le cluster redis
- La réplication du cluster Redis est un mécanisme de redondance de données qui utilise le modèle maître-esclave pour implémenter: l'instance maître gère et lit, envoyant des modifications de données à la réplique. L'instance de réplique est uniquement responsable de la lecture, de la réception et du stockage des changements de données à partir de l'instance principale. Grâce à l'implémentation du protocole de réplication, l'instance maître suit l'état de réplique et envoie progressivement les changements de base de données. Fournit une haute disponibilité, une évolutivité et une protection des données. La configuration inclut la sélection de l'instance principale, la création d'une réplique, l'activation de la réplication et la surveillance du processus de réplication.
- Redis 584 2025-04-10 16:42:02
-
- Que signifie le pipeline redis
- Redis Pipeline est une technologie qui lance les commandes Redis qui réduisent les frais généraux du réseau, améliorent le débit et réduisent la latence. Il est implémenté en emballant plusieurs commandes en une seule demande et en les envoyant au serveur Redis. Utilisez le bloc d'essai lors de l'utilisation du pipeline, limitant le nombre de commandes et uniquement en cas de besoin.
- Redis 793 2025-04-10 16:39:01
-
- Que signifie l'instance redis
- Une instance Redis fait référence à un processus de course séparé utilisé pour stocker et gérer les données. Chaque instance a sa propre configuration, données, politiques de persistance et connexions clients. Il peut être utilisé pour des cas d'utilisation tels que la mise en cache, la file d'attente de messages, les bases de données et la gestion de session.
- Redis 657 2025-04-10 16:36:02
-
- Que signifie redis haute disponibilité?
- Redis High Disponibilité signifie que les clusters Redis peuvent toujours fournir des services en cas d'échec ou d'interruption, garantissant les données complètes et disponibles. Les méthodes pour atteindre la haute disponibilité de Redis sont: la réplication maître-esclave: créer plusieurs nœuds d'esclaves redis, et le nœud maître est responsable de l'écriture et de la copie des données. Sentinel: surveille l'état de santé du maître Redis et des nœuds esclaves. Lorsque le nœud maître échoue, le nœud esclave sera automatiquement promu au nœud maître. Redis Cluster: une architecture distribuée qui stocke des éclats de données sur plusieurs nœuds redis. Lorsque le nœud maître échoue, le nœud esclave reprendra automatiquement le rôle du nœud maître. Les avantages des clusters Redis à haute disponibilité comprennent: la non-interruption du service, l'intégrité des données, l'évolutivité et la reprise après sinistre.
- Redis 461 2025-04-10 16:33:01